Rising Global Burden and Sex Disparities in Nonmelanoma Skin Cancer: 1990-2021 Trends With Projections to 2036.
OBJECTIVE Nonmelanoma skin cancer (NMSC), mainly comprising basal and squamous cell carcinomas, is among the most common cancers worldwide. Despite its low mortality, the rising incidence imposes substantial health and economic burdens. This study assessed the global NMSC burden (1990-2021), examined sex-specific regional patterns, and projected trends to 2036 to inform equitable public health strategies. METHODS Data on NMSC from 1990 to 2021 were retrieved from the 2021 Global Burden of Disease Study across 204 countries. Key indicators included incidence, mortality, and disability-adjusted life years (DALYs), stratified by sex, age, region, and Sociodemographic Index (SDI). Temporal trends were evaluated using age-standardized rates, and the future burden (2022-2036) was projected using autoregressive integrated moving average (ARIMA) models. RESULTS Globally, NMSC cases rose 2.8-fold from 1990 to 2021, reaching 6.3 million in 2021. Men accounted for 58% of cases and 59% of DALYs, with higher incidence, mortality, and DALY rates than women, especially in those 70 years or older, and the sex gap widened over time in high-SDI regions. In adults aged 15 to 49, incidence was occasionally higher in women. Regionally, high-income North America showed the highest incidence, whereas East Asia had the greatest deaths and DALYs. By 2036, global incidence is projected to nearly double, with a steeper increase in men. CONCLUSIONS The global burden of NMSC is rising, and men consistently experience higher incidence, mortality, and DALY rates than women. The expanding sex gap, especially among older adults and in high-SDI regions, highlights the urgent need for targeted and sex-specific prevention, early detection, and public health interventions.
